I've got a 9 speed, triple chainring set-up on my Specialized Tricross and the time has come to renew the middle chainring which has become very tired. However, what I'd like to do is take the opportunity to upgrade the chainset and the bottom bracket rather than just replacing the middle ring.

The chainset I've got on the bike at the moment is a cheapy FSA Tempo (50/39/30) with a square taper bottom bracket. I've been looking at the Shimano 105 triples in the same 50/39/30 size with Hollotech BBs, but they all seem to be for 10 speed set-ups. I've got a 9 speed rig on the back end. Does anyone know whether a 105 chainset will work okay with 9 speed when it's rated for 10 speed?

Thanks Pete. What's the difference between a 10 speed chainset and a 9 speed chainset then? Are the rings on the 10 speed just a tad closer together or something?
I don't think there is any functional difference, if you buy new chainrings, they fit 9 and 10 speed, they're often stamped as such. There's not a specific 9 speed or a specific 10 speed chainring. One fits both.
